Storm window installation services involve attaching additional windows to existing window frames to provide an extra layer of protection and insulation. These services typically include measuring, selecting appropriate storm window types, and securely installing them to ensure a snug fit. The process helps improve energy efficiency by reducing drafts and heat loss, making indoor spaces more comfortable during colder months. Professionals may also ensure that the storm windows operate smoothly and seal properly to prevent air leaks and water infiltration.
One of the primary issues storm window installation addresses is energy loss through existing windows, which can lead to higher heating and cooling costs. Storm windows serve as an effective barrier against drafts, reducing the strain on heating and air conditioning systems. Additionally, they help protect primary windows from damage caused by harsh weather conditions, such as wind, rain, and snow. Proper installation can also prevent issues like rattling, condensation buildup, and moisture intrusion, which can compromise window integrity over time.

Material Costs - The cost for storm window materials typically ranges from $50 to $150 per window, depending on size and type. Larger or specialty windows may cost more, with prices reaching up to $200 each.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. The total cost can vary based on window complexity and local labor rates.
Additional Fees - Some projects may incur extra charges for removal of old windows or special frame adjustments, which can add $50 to $100 per window. These costs depend on the specific installation requirements.
Overall Project Budget - For a typical home with 10 windows, the total cost for storm window installation might range from $1,500 to $4,000. Actual prices vary based on window size, material choices, and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window panels install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to provide extra insulation and protection against weather elements.
How long does storm window installation typically take? The installation duration varies dep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the project, but most installations can be completed within a day or two.
Are storm windows suitable for all types of existing windows? Storm windows can be installed on most standard window types, but it is best to consult with a professional to determine compatibility.
What are the benefits of installing storm windows? Installing storm windows can improve energ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and protect existing windows from damage caused by weather.
